Canceling your Canva auto-renewal is a relatively straightforward process. Here are the steps to follow: * Log in to your Canva account using your email address and password. * Click on your profile picture or initials in the top right corner of the screen, then select “Account settings” from the dropdown menu. * Scroll down to the “Billing” section and click on “Subscription”. * Click on the “Cancel subscription” button. * Confirm that you want to cancel your subscription by clicking on the “Cancel subscription” button again.📝 Note: If you're using a free trial, you'll need to cancel your subscription before the trial period ends to avoid being charged.
What Happens After Canceling Auto Renewal?
After canceling your Canva auto-renewal, you’ll still have access to your account and all of its features until the end of your current billing period. Once your subscription expires, you’ll be downgraded to a free plan, and you’ll lose access to the premium features and benefits that come with a paid subscription.Alternative Design Tools
